27-37 Well Street, London
Open: 8:00 am - 10:00 pm8.95 mi 135 High Street, Beckenham, London
Open: 8:00 am - 10:00 pm8.96 mi Ruislip Road, London
Open: 8:00 am - 10:00 pm9.01 mi 104 -120 Lee High Road, London
Open: 8:00 am - 10:00 pm9.11 mi 482 Uxbridge Road, London
Open: 8:00 am - 10:00 pm9.21 mi Botwell Lane, London
Open: 8:00 am - 10:00 pm9.35 mi